Hyderabad school topper, who lost grandparents to blaze, dies in hospital as family struggles to pay for treatment | India News


Sruti Gupta, the 15-year-old intermediate student from Hyderabad who had been battling for life after a fire at her home last Monday, died at the Gandhi Hospital on Saturday morning.

Her grandparents, who had raised her since she was a toddler, had died of smoke inhalation in the fire that engulfed their home in Yakutpura area. Fire and police personnel found Sruti, who was doing intermediate first year and was a school topper, unconscious in her room on the first floor.

Majlis Bachao Tehreek leader Amjed Ullah Khan, who helped Sruti’s family pay the medical expenses through crowdfunding, said that the girl’s health deteriorated in the ICU.

“Late Friday night, she became unresponsive and was shifted to Gandhi Hospital, where she breathed her last in the morning. The tragedy is no one helped this brilliant girl in spite of so many appeals… The crowdfunding helped raise about Rs 1 lakh only, which went to pay for medicines, while her family paid Rs 2 lakh for the treatment,” Khan said.

“In some cases we are able to raise a minimum of Rs 5 lakh but in Sruti’s case we struggled to raise Rs 2 lakh. Most of the donations were of Rs 100,” he said.

An official from Chief Minister A Revanth Reddy’s office said the CM had taken note of Sruti’s condition on Friday and had directed officials to ensure the best treatment for the teenager.

Sruti’s uncle Ganesh Lal said they ran out of money to pay the hospital bills. “Her condition worsened and we shifted her to Gandhi Hospital. She fought for her life and gave up,” he said.

Sruti lost her mother when she was a child and her father migrated to South Africa, leaving her with her grandparents. On Monday night, a fire spread in the kitchen of their one-storey house and firecrackers the family had bought for Diwali also caught fire. Sruti’s grandparents Mohal Lal Gupta, 58, and his wife Usha Gupta, 55, died of smoke inhalation while she was taken to Yashoda Hospital.
